Job description

Georgia-Pacific is looking for safety-oriented individuals to join our team asan Assistant Machine Operator in McDonough, GA!

  • $25.25 per hour
  • Shift differential is $1.00 per hour between the hours of 7pm and 7am
  • You will have the ability to increase your compensation based on skills and contribution to the overall performance of the plant.
  • This role is eligible for our Performance Pay program that could offer up to a 6% quarterly bonus.
Shift
  • This facility works a Dupont schedule (rotating 12-hour shifts).You will work both shifts on a rotating basis, which are 645am-7pm and 645pm-7am .There are days off between your night and day rotations.
  • What is a Dupont Schedule? Click here to find out.
  • Only candidates who are able to work this schedule will be considered.
  • McDonough operates on a point-based attendance program.
Our Team

Georgia-Pacific’s Mailers is a part of the Packaging and Cellulose business, the Mailers business is expanding its product lines, working with key customers to create and launch one or more new products to complement our already thriving recyclable padded mailer business.

  • Perform necessary functions to operate the line with minimal supervision while maintaining facility standards in safety, productivity, waste, housekeeping and quality standards
  • Operate the line while the lead operator is assisting other lines or performing other tasks
  • Perform minor mechanical repairs and adjustments; operates in line systems with minimal supervision including manual duties such as handpacking
  • Perform makeready/changeover machine setups according to production schedules
  • Consistently looks for improvements and efficiencies to reduce waste and increase production within quality standards set
  • Drive safety excellence through promoting employee involvement and ownership
  • Scan all material related to the job ticket into Plex at time of use and ensure that scrap is recorded correctly once material has been consumed completely
  • Maintain and clean machines and work area as needed
Who You Are (Basic Qualifications)
  • 1+ years’ experience operating production machinery
  • Previous experience in a manufacturing, military, or industrial environment
  • Knowledge of machines and tools, including their designs, uses, repair and maintenance
  • This role works rotating 12 hours shifts, with a 7-day break in every 28-day period
What Will Put You Ahead
  • 2+ years of experience as a paper setter, operator, tender, or printing process experience such as offset printing, digital printing, web printing, or corrugating or converting experience, including inspecting quality of printed materials for alignment, registration and print defects
  • 1+ years of experience working in a maintenance department
  • Experience with the make ready process to prepare equipment for a new job
  • Experience trouble shooting machine setup, adjusting machines and solutioning key issues safely
  • Experience using a computer, tablet, or smart device
  • Ability to read a tape measure in both standard and metric units of measure
Other Considerations/Physical Requirements
  • This role will perform tasks such as lifting 35 lbs, walking, climbing, stooping, standing, sitting, pushing and/or pulling for up to 12 hours/day in a loud/noisy, and high-volume environment
